  • In this video, Steve shows you how to preserve the correct space for the handle of the club to travel around the arc for the best possible results. More distance, more accuracy, and more sweet spot hits!
    Follow these tips and drills to increase clubhead speed, smash factor, driver distance, and have more FUN!
